Job Description

Under general supervision, the Crime Analyst performs crime and intelligence analysis for reporting and presenting crime information, statistical trends, and criminal intelligence in support of the Police Department.

Posted range is the starting salary. Pay rate offered is based on experience.

  • Evaluate information, select essential elements, and correlate new information with existing information. Analyze findings, make interpretations, and write comprehensive reports based on these data.
  • Performs tactical crime and intelligence analysis to support investigations and patrol efforts. Works as part of a team with other analysts, sworn personnel, and personnel from other agencies to provide analytical assistance, collect and disseminate intelligence, and share resources.
  • Thinks critically, questions assumptions, and avoids bias with respect to sources, research methods, and document creation.
  • Develops a variety of analytical products and facilitates the transfer of information between local, state, and federal agencies.
  • Uses a variety of software applications and resources most at an intermediate level.
  • Demonstrates continuous effort to improve operations, decrease turnaround times, streamline work processes, and work cooperatively and jointly to provide quality seamless customer service.
  • Graduation from an accredited four (4) year college or university with major course work in Criminal Justice, Social Science, or in a related field. Experience may substitute for education on a year to year basis up to a maximum of four years.
  • Minimum two (2) years required in research, crime or intelligence analysis, and/or the interpretation of law enforcement data. A Master's Degree in a relevant field of study may be substituted for two (2) years of experience.
  • Valid class C driver's license. Ability to pass a background investigation. May be required to obtain federal secret security clearance.

Preferred:
  • Certification by the International Association of Crime Analysts or the International Association of Law Enforcement Intelligence Analysts.
